Ho una vista che ha in cima uno UITextView
quindi una serie di altre viste. L'idea è di ridimensionare la vista del testo sulla sua dimensione del contenuto e di spostare tutte le altre viste.TextView dinamico con storyboard e layout automatico
Ho impostato tutti i vincoli nello storyboard e se cambio il valore del vincolo di altezza del mio TextView da lì, tutti gli aggiornamenti della vista vanno bene.
In fase di esecuzione, è possibile ridimensionare il riquadro Vista testo per adattarlo alla dimensione del contenuto, ma il resto della vista non cambia. Quindi suppongo di non dover cambiare la cornice ma solo il vincolo di altezza.
Qualche suggerimento su come è possibile fare questa cosa in runtime? Come posso modificare il valore del vincolo di altezza nel codice? C'è un modo per "collegare" un vincolo al controller dallo storyboard?
Grazie per l'aiuto
Questo non funziona per me, 'textview.contentSize.height' non restituisce il giusto valore. – AnthonyR